We like apes as much as anyone, but this is ridiculous! We think the only one’s who could ride this would be NBA centers and anyone who has gigantism! Otherwise, this is just a trailer queen/king…or something like that.

Of course, the whole thing looks like it’s a non-working piece of sculpture. So someone clearly had a lot of time on their hands.